Gallas warns Cole of Mourinho factor
Published in FilGoal on 03 - 09 - 2006

French defender William Gallas has warned Chelsea's new-signing Ashley Cole from coach Jose Mourinho.
Cole moved from Arsenal to Chelsea in a swap deal that saw Gallas going in the opposite direction.
"I wish Cole luck and I hope he has the patience to put up with his manager," Gallas told The People in an interview on Sunday.
"Mourinho is a good trainer but he is fickle with his players," the French international added.
Gallas had repeatedly asked to leave Stamford Bridge and the relationship with his Portuguese manager had a dead end.
"The threat of making me play in the reserves is incredible when you consider what I have given to this club.
"In the last few years I have had offers from Italy and Spain but I have stayed loyal to Chelsea. But this has counted for nothing with Mourinho and that is sad.
"I have survived the last few weeks taking one day at a time believing that in the end things would work out for the best.

And warns Cole of Mourinho's "fickle" attitude
The 29-year-old has expressed his happiness in joining the Gunners.
"I wanted to leave Chelsea and Arsenal was the perfect club for me.
"They wanted me, they are a team going for all honors, and I am very happy in London and have a lot of friends here.
"I'm happy that I have joined Arsenal. I'm sure I will be treated better by their coaching staff than I have been by Mourinho in the last year.
Gallas portrayed Mourinho as a dictator and accused him of mistreating his players.
"What has happened to me has happened in the past to Ricardo Carvalho, Mateja Kezman, Paulo Ferreira, Asier Del Horno and Hernan Crespo. He uses us for his convenience.
"In the dressing room my teammates have been supportive but Mourinho is the boss and so nobody has spoken out for me," the Frenchman added.
Gallas is seeking a fresh start with Arsenal where coach Arsene Wenger is building a lot of hopes on him.
"I just need to start giving the performances on the pitch for Arsenal. I hope I win over the fans and they forget my past as a Blue."
